Filters:
steak house in Southwark
About 5 results.
CAU St Katharine Docks
Commodity Quay 1, E1W 1AZ London, United KingdomWhen it comes to a location as spectacular as our beef, you can’t beat CAU St Katharine’s Docks. Located straight across from the Tower of London on the River Thames, it offers it offers unique m…
Gaucho
2 More London Riverside, SE1 2AP London, United KingdomSpectacular views are the order of the day at Gaucho Tower Bridge, where old meets new on the South Bank skyline.
Hawksmoor Borough
Winchester Walk 16, SE1 9AQ London, United KingdomBritish steakhouses and cocktail bars | “Flawless. The best steak you will find anywhere.” Giles Coren, The Times
The Camberwell Arms
65 Camberwell Church St, Se5 8tr London, United KingdomFor booking enquiries please contact us enquiries@thecamberwellarms.co.uk